Clive Phillips

Clive Phillips obtained a PhD in dairy cow nutrition and behaviour from the University of Glasgow. He spent his first 20 years lecturing about, and researching, livestock production and welfare at the Universities of Cambridge and Wales. In 2003 he joined the University of Queensland’s School of Veterinary Science as the inaugural Chair in Animal Welfare, where he established the Centre for Animal Welfare and Ethics. He edits a journal in the field, Animals, and a series of books on animal welfare. Recently his research has covered a range of areas related to the welfare of animals, mainly livestock, and with a particular interest in the live export of cattle and sheep from Australia. Other research interests included the sustainability of livestock production systems and animal ethics and animal welfare research ethics. His latest book, The Animal Trade, was published by CABI in 2015.
